如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

滑动窗口机制动画视频:深入浅出理解网络传输的核心技术

滑动窗口机制动画视频:深入浅出理解网络传输的核心技术

在网络通信中,滑动窗口机制是确保数据传输可靠性和效率的关键技术之一。今天,我们将通过滑动窗口机制动画视频来深入浅出地介绍这一概念,并探讨其在实际应用中的重要性。

什么是滑动窗口机制?

滑动窗口机制是一种流量控制技术,用于在发送方和接收方之间协调数据传输速度。它的核心思想是通过一个“窗口”来限制发送方一次性发送的数据量,从而避免网络拥塞和数据丢失。滑动窗口机制动画视频通过动态的图形展示,让我们直观地看到窗口如何在发送和接收过程中移动,调整大小,以及如何处理确认和重传。

滑动窗口的工作原理

  1. 窗口大小:发送方维护一个发送窗口,窗口的大小决定了可以发送但未确认的数据量。接收方也有自己的接收窗口,用于告知发送方它可以接收的数据量。

  2. 确认机制:接收方在接收到数据后,会发送确认(ACK)给发送方。发送方收到确认后,窗口会向前滑动,允许发送新的数据。

  3. 超时重传:如果发送方在一定时间内没有收到确认,会重新发送未确认的数据。

  4. 窗口调整:根据网络状况,接收方可以动态调整窗口大小,通知发送方增加或减少发送速率。

滑动窗口机制动画视频的优势

  • 直观展示:通过动画,用户可以清晰地看到数据包的发送、确认和窗口的移动过程。
  • 易于理解:复杂的网络协议通过动画简化,降低了学习门槛。
  • 实时演示:动画可以模拟不同网络条件下的传输情况,帮助理解各种场景下的滑动窗口行为。

滑动窗口机制的应用

  1. TCP协议:滑动窗口是TCP协议中的核心机制,用于确保数据的可靠传输。通过滑动窗口机制动画视频,我们可以看到TCP如何通过窗口大小来控制流量。

  2. 网络优化:在网络优化工具中,滑动窗口机制被用来提高网络性能,减少延迟和丢包率。

  3. 流媒体传输:在视频直播或点播服务中,滑动窗口机制帮助管理数据流,确保视频流畅播放。

  4. 云计算和数据中心:在云环境中,滑动窗口机制用于管理服务器之间的数据传输,确保高效和可靠的数据交换。

  5. 移动网络:在移动通信中,滑动窗口机制帮助优化数据传输,适应移动网络的动态变化。

如何学习滑动窗口机制

学习滑动窗口机制的最佳方式之一就是观看滑动窗口机制动画视频。这些视频通常会:

  • 展示基本概念和工作原理。
  • 通过实际案例演示滑动窗口在不同网络环境下的表现。
  • 提供交互式学习体验,让用户可以调整参数,观察结果。

总结

滑动窗口机制是网络通信中不可或缺的一部分,通过滑动窗口机制动画视频,我们不仅能更直观地理解其工作原理,还能看到它在实际应用中的表现。无论你是网络工程师、学生还是对网络技术感兴趣的爱好者,这些动画视频都是学习和理解滑动窗口机制的绝佳资源。通过这种方式,我们可以更好地掌握网络传输的核心技术,提升网络性能和用户体验。

希望这篇博文能帮助大家更好地理解滑动窗口机制,并通过滑动窗口机制动画视频找到学习的乐趣和效率。